I can provide some insights into the environmental impact and considerations related to plastic and metal utensils when dining out at restaurants:

  1. Plastic Utensils:

    • Pros: Disposable plastic utensils are lightweight, convenient, and often individually wrapped, which can be useful for take-out or on-the-go dining. They are also inexpensive, which may save costs for restaurants.
    • Cons: Plastic utensils contribute significantly to plastic pollution, especially if they are not properly disposed of or recycled. They can take hundreds of years to decompose, leading to environmental harm, particularly in marine ecosystems.
  2. Metal Utensils:

    • Pros: Reusable metal utensils, such as stainless steel or silverware, are more durable and long-lasting than plastic. They can be easily cleaned and sterilized, making them a more sanitary option. Using metal utensils reduces the amount of single-use plastic waste generated.
    • Cons: The initial cost of metal utensils may be higher for restaurants compared to disposable plastic ones. Additionally, maintaining cleanliness and hygiene is crucial to ensure their safe reuse.

Given the environmental impact of single-use plastics, many individuals and establishments are shifting towards more sustainable practices, including offering reusable metal utensils, biodegradable alternatives, or encouraging customers to bring their own utensils. As a conscious consumer, choosing metal utensils or carrying your own reusable set can help reduce plastic waste and contribute to a more environmentally friendly dining experience.
